'Cliffe Council Passes New Course Proposal

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The final draft of the recommendation for a "Critique of Current Issues" course passed the Radcliffe Student Council yesterday and will now be submitted to the Committee on General Education for approval. If approved, it will then be considered by the Faculty Committee.

The recommendation suggests that the course, somewhat similar to Dartmouth's "Great Issues" class, should be an upper level General Education course, open only to juniors and seniors. A different specialist would lecture each week and daily reading of at least one newspaper would be required.
